Mounting Thermaltake PT40-D5 pump/radiator in Thermaltake Core V21
I started a new built (spring is around the corner) and I opted for a Thermaltake Core V21 (ATX) case and their new water cooling solutions. I went with the RL-240 Kit which has all the basics. The problem I ran into was the pump/reservoir seemed to be too large for the case. With a little thought I was able to successfully mount the system perfectly. Tools and materials required.. electric dril, 2 old expansion slot covers.
